某型导弹加速度信号源设计 被引量:1

Design of Certain Type Missile Acceleration Signal Source

摘要 为实现某型导弹的地面测试,设计一种能够实时产生模拟过载的加速度信号源。根据导弹再入运动模型,利用Matlab软件仿真出速度-高度、加速度-高度、加速度-时间关系数据,采用C8051F020单片机和模拟放大电路,输出导弹再入弹道的加速度信号,提供给弹上控制系统。结果表明:该加速度信号源能提高单片机运行效率,较好地完成导弹地面测试任务。 In order to achieve the ground test for certain type missile, an acceleration signal source which generated simulated overload in real time was designed. According to the reentry motion model of the missile, the Matlab software was used to simulate speed-height, acceleration-height, acceleration-time relationship data, C8051F020 single chip microcomputer and analog amplifying circuit were used to output the acceleration signals of missile reentry trajectory, and the signals were provided to control system of the missile. The results showed that, the acceleration signal source could improve the operating efficiency of the single chip microcomputer, and the ground test task of the missile was well completed.
